Lemont is a perfect 10-0 against Thornton Fractional South since May of 2019 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Tuesday. The Lemont HS will look to defend their home field against the Red Wolves at 4:30 p.m. Lemont is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 8.8 runs per game this season.
Lemont came out on top against Bremen on Monday thanks in part to the team's impressive 12-run second inning. The Lemont HS blew past the Braves 17-5. Considering the Lemont HS have won 11 matchups by more than five runs this season, Monday's blowout was nothing new.

Lemont let Ava Zdenovec and Emma Lagan run wild. Zdenovec went 3-for-4 with three runs, one triple, and two RBI, while Lagan went 3-for-4 with three RBI and one double. Those three runs gave Zdenovec a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Sydney Kibbon,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with two doubles and one run.
Lemont always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.556.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Bremen only posted an OBP of .385.
Meanwhile, Thornton Fractional South was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their third straight loss. They came up short against Tinley Park, falling 17-2. Having soared to a lofty ten runs in the game before, the Red Wolves couldn't push the score so high this time.
Lemont has been performing well recently as they've won five of their last six cont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 11-4 record this season. The w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 11.5 runs over those games. As for Thornton Fractional South, their defeat dropped their record down to 1-12.
Lemont took their victory against Thornton Fractional South in their previous meeting back in May of 2024 by a conclusive 9-2 score. Do the Lemont HS have another victory up their sleeve, or will the Red Wolves tur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
